cryo transport, also known as cryogenic transportation, is a method of moving materials at extremely low temperatures to maintain their stability and integrity. This specialized mode of transport is used for a variety of purposes, from preserving biological samples to transporting perishable goods. In this article, we will explore the advantages of cryo transport and how it plays a crucial role in various industries.

One of the main advantages of cryo transport is its ability to keep materials at precise temperatures throughout the transportation process. By using cryogenic gases such as liquid nitrogen or liquid helium, items can be maintained at temperatures as low as -196°C. This is essential for preserving biological samples, such as stem cells, tissues, and organs, as well as maintaining the quality of perishable goods like food and pharmaceuticals.

In the field of medicine and research, cryo transport is invaluable for maintaining the viability of biological samples. By keeping these samples at ultra-low temperatures, their shelf life can be extended significantly, allowing for more time for analysis, experiments, or future use. For example, stem cells are often transported using cryo transport to ensure they remain viable for regenerative medicine applications. Additionally, organs for transplant can be safely transported over long distances without compromising their quality, thanks to cryo transport.

The food industry also benefits greatly from cryo transport. Perishable goods, such as seafood, meats, fruits, and vegetables, can be transported over long distances without the risk of spoilage. By keeping these items at sub-zero temperatures, the growth of bacteria and other pathogens is inhibited, prolonging the shelf life of the products. This means that consumers can enjoy fresh, high-quality food products that have been transported safely and efficiently.

Another advantage of cryo transport is its ability to reduce the risk of contamination during transportation. By keeping items at low temperatures, the growth of microorganisms is slowed down, reducing the risk of foodborne illnesses or spoilage. This is especially important when transporting sensitive products that require strict temperature control, such as vaccines or biopharmaceuticals. cryo transport ensures that these items remain safe and effective throughout the journey from manufacturer to end-user.
